Jack Meister compiled a career record of 8 wins and 18 losses and a 7.84 ERA in his 63-game pitching career with the Boise Pilots, Vancouver Capilanos, Seattle Rainiers, Yakima Stars and Great Falls Electrics. He began playing during the 1946 season and last took the field during the 1948 campaign.
